About G3D Mark
G3D Mark is a standard benchmark that measures graphics performance in real-world gaming scenarios. It simplifies comparing cards from different brands, where higher scores directly correlate with better fps and smoother gaming experiences.

GRID M6-1Q vs Radeon Ryzen 5 5600U Technical Specifications
Side-by-side specs, architecture details, clocks, memory, power, and platform differences.

GRID M6-1Q
The GRID M6-1Q is manufactured by NVIDIA. It was released in August 30 2015. It features the Maxwell 2.0 architecture. The core clock ranges from 557 MHz to 1178 MHz. It has 2048 shading units. The thermal design power (TDP) is 225W. Manufactured using 28 nm process technology. G3D Mark benchmark score: 2,069 points.


Radeon Ryzen 5 5600U
The Radeon Ryzen 5 5600U is manufactured by AMD. It was released in October 7 2019. It features the RDNA 1.0 architecture. The boost clock speed is 1845 MHz. It has 1408 shading units. The thermal design power (TDP) is 110W. Manufactured using 7 nm process technology. G3D Mark benchmark score: 2,095 points.
Graphics Performance
The GRID M6-1Q scores 2,069 and the Radeon Ryzen 5 5600U reaches 2,095 in the G3D Mark benchmark — just a 1.3% difference, making them near-identical in rasterization performance. The GRID M6-1Q is built on Maxwell 2.0 while the Radeon Ryzen 5 5600U uses RDNA 1.0, both on 28 nm vs 7 nm. Shader units: 2,048 (GRID M6-1Q) vs 1,408 (Radeon Ryzen 5 5600U). Raw compute: 4.825 TFLOPS (GRID M6-1Q) vs 5.196 TFLOPS (Radeon Ryzen 5 5600U). Boost clocks: 1178 MHz vs 1845 MHz.
